Financial services grid computing on amazon web services. Advantages and disadvantages and applications of grid. Grid software creates virtual windows supercomputer. Amazon web services financial services grid computing on aws january 2016 page 6 of 24 subset of engines. It is typically run on a data grid, a set of computers that directly interact with each other to coordinate jobs. In a cloud computing system, there are minimal hardware and software demands on users. Dec 09, 2005 grid computing requires the use of software that can divide and farm out pieces of a program to as many as several thousand computers. Shepherdstown 26 december 2006this article provides a high level overview of grid computing in healthcare at this point in time. A network of computers running special grid computing network software. Jan 25, 2017 grid computing is a processor architecture that combines computer resources from various domains to reach a main objective. Term computational grid comes from an analogy with the electric power.
Finding hardware and software that allows these utilities to get provided commonly provides cost, security, and availability issues. The size of a grid may vary from smallconfined to a network of computer workstations within a corporation, for exampleto large, public collaborations across many companies and networks. Smart grid incorporates has many benefits of distributed computing and communications to deliver realtime information and enable the nearinstantaneous balance of supply and demand at the device level. The technology is still fairly nascent, but here at the developerworks grid computing zone, were publishing a steady stream of new articles, tutorials, resources, and tools to bring developers up to speed on this important, cuttingedge technology. Smart grid safeguards our nations position at the forefront of the worlds transition toward a clean energy future. Grid computing is the collection of computer resources from multiple locations to reach a common goal.
World community grid world community grids mission is to create the largest public computing grid benefiting humanity, which is funded and operated by ibm. Exactly where along that continuum one might say that a particular solution is an implementation of grid computing versus a relatively simple implementation using virtual resources is a matter of opinion. Benefits of grid computing for korganizations, proceedings of the 5th international conference on knowledge management. Grid computing advantages and disadvantages toolbox. At the heart of grid computing is the concept that applications and resources are connected in the form of a pervasive network fabric or grid. A data grid is a set of structured services that provides multiple services like the ability to access, alter and transfer very large amounts of geographically separated data, especially for research and collaboration purposes. You can find lots of software and systems that uses grid computing as a resource to achieve high performance, to provide high availability, and to reduce costs. Can solve larger, more complex problems in a shorter time. Its kind of like the borg all the resources become part of the collective, but in a good way. Processes analytics jobs faster, and provides more efficient computing resource utilization. The term grid computing collectively defines a set of distributed computing use cases that have certain technical aspects in common. A sas grid environment also provides the flexibility to incrementally grow the computing infrastructure as the number of users and the size of data increase over time as well as the ability to do rolling maintenance and upgrades without any disruption to the user community.
Grid computing has been around for a few years now and its advantages are many. Advantages disadvantage of grid computing advantages. Grid computing is not a technical term it is a marketing term. In grid computing, the computers on the network can work on a task together, thus functioning as a supercomputer. Grid computing enables the virtualisation of distributed computing and data resources such as processing, network bandwidth and storage capacity to create a single system image, granting users and applications seamless ac. What are the advantages and disadvantages grid computing. Cloud computing technologies virtualization, soa, grid computing and utility computing duration. Flexible grid computing capabilities allow portfolio managers to conduct simulations that. The idea behind grid computing is to make multiple machines that may be in different. The grid software will perform the necessary calculations and decide. Grid based storage systems, an outgrowth of distributed computing, have in turn focused on data storage services. Gridbased storage systems, an outgrowth of distributed computing, have in turn focused on data storage services. The research grid offers more memory, speed, and processing power through a single entry point. However, there are dozens of different definitions for grid computing and there seems to be no consensus on what a grid is.
Grids mission is to create the largest public computing grid that benefits humanity. Can solve larger, more complex problems in a shorter. Agc 4 isr architecture is organize with autonomic grid computing and c 4 isr command. Shared computing usually refers to a collection of computers that share processing power in order to complete a specific task. These include gridpp, osg, and the berkeley seti research center, who use grid computing to process astounding data loads.
Grid computing is still a developing field and is related to several other innovative computing systems, some of which are subcategories of grid computing. A simple computer grid model consists of a central control node, which connects to local or distributed computing resources via loadsharing software. Agc 4 isr architecture is organize with autonomic grid. Now the question arises,what is grid computing,as u see in this figure grid computing or the use of a computational grid is applying the resources of many computers in a network to a single problem at the same time usually to a scientific or technical problem that. The technology is still fairly nascent, but here at the developerworks grid computing zone, were publishing a steady stream of new articles, tutorials, resources, and tools. Reliability, cost savings, and energy independence are just three of the many benefits of smart grid. Apr 16, 2004 as described earlier, initially, the focused grid computing activities were in the areas of computing power, data access, and storage resources.
Grid computing is created to provide a solution to specific issues, such as problems that require a large number of processing cycles or access to a large amount of data. Advantages of grid computing business benefits technology benefits improve. Grid computing is distinguished from conventional highperformance computing systems such as cluster computing in that grid computers have each node set to perform a different taskapplication. Grid computing represents a big step in the world of computing. One advantage of grid computing is that it allows one to share computer. A computing grid can be thought of as a distributed system with noninteractive workloads that involve many files. Several grid middleware software systems are available for building highend computing grids and their applications. It is the form of distributed computing or peertopeer computing. Grid computing is distinguished from conventional highperformance computing systems such as cluster computing in that grid computers have each node set to. Grid computing is a group of networked computers that work together as a virtual supercomputer to perform large tasks, such as analyzing huge sets of data or weather modeling.
Grid computing by camiel plevier 3 grid concept many heterogeneous computers over the whole world can be used to provide a lot of cpu power and data storage capacity applications can be executed at several locations combining geographically distributed services collaboration seamless access, web services grid computing by. Current grid activities introduction to grid computing. Introduction to grid computing december 2005 international technical support organization sg24677800. Ibm learning services education programs, workshops, and ibm products for.
Grid computing makes more resources available to more people and organizations while allowing those responsible for the it infrastructure to enhance resource balancing, reliability, and. Using the idle time of computers around the world, world community grids research projects have analyzed aspects of the human genome, hiv, dengue, muscular dystrophy, and cancer. Delivers enterpriseclass dynamic workload balancing for multiple users and applications. This paper is proposed new software architecture to incorporate smart grid and agc 4 isr architecture. The definition of grid computing resource sharing has since changed, based upon experiences, with more focus now being applied to a sophisticated form of coordinated resource sharing distributed. Grid computing foster and kesselman, 1997 is a form of distributed computing in which use is made of a grid composed of networked, looselycoupled computers, data storage systems, instruments, etc. Bank of america uses a sas grid environment to reduce loan default calculation times from 96 hours down to just 4 saving valuable time and money. Now the question arises,what is grid computing,as u see in this figure grid computing or the use of a computational grid is applying the resources of many computers in a network to a single problem at the same time usually to a scientific or. The ability to optimize resources through load sharing, scheduling, and queuing of jobs across multiple servers access to a browserbased interface for submitting jobs in addition to the usual connection through ssh. Pdf new software architecture for smart grid computing. With the grid these resources will be provided on a much larger scale and standard communication mechanisms will allow collaboration between heterogeneous environments. Cornell university is creating a new software platform for grid operators called gridcontrol that will utilize cloud computing to more efficiently control the grid. The impact of grid computing on business bcs the chartered.
Projects, systems and technologies,bucharest, november 12 2010 14, faculty of economic cybernetics, statistics and informatics, academy of economic studies and. One advantage of a data grid is the ability to replicate the data at various sites. But in heterogeneous windowsbased environments which cant be altered and without any contention, i cant really see much benefit in costly grid software. Many groups are reluctant with sharing resources even if it benefits everyone involved. As all resources are connected via the grid the software can be developed in.
Nov 20, 2012 xoreax got its start back in 2002 and for the last 10 years, theyve been accelerating software in the windows environment, using distributed, aka grid, computing technology. Data from different regions are pulled from administrative domains which filter data for security. Pardeshi1, 3chitra patil2,snehal dhumale lecturer,computer department,ssbts coet,bambhori abstractgrid computing has become another buzzword after web 2. Grid computing has been around for over 12 years now and its. Paper sas42402016 creating a strong business case for. Oct 30, 2012 the grid can be thought of as a distributed system with noninteractive workloads that involve a large number of files. Grid computing makes more resources available to more people and organizations while allowing those responsible for the it infrastructure to enhance resource balancing, reliability, and manageability. The grid can be thought of as a distributed system with noninteractive workloads that involve a large number of files. Includes highavailability capabilities for all critical services. Grid computing is the practice of leveraging multiple computers, often geographically distributed but connected by networks, to work together to accomplish joint tasks. Sas grid manager is the sas implementation of grid computing for sas software. Projects, systems and technologies,bucharest, november 12 2010 14, faculty of economic cybernetics, statistics and informatics, academy of economic studies and national defence university carol i. The timeframe for the completion of grid calculations tends to be minutes or.
A computing grid is constructed with the help of grid middleware software that allows them to communicate. The grid is about sharing resources, said tom hawk, general manager of grid computing for ibm. Grid computing has been around for over 12 years now and its advantages are many. Resources are known to each other in some way, and able to transfer data and requests for actions using agreed protocols encapsulated in. Grid computing is a group of networked computers which work together as a virtual supercomputer to perform large tasks, such as analysing huge sets of data or weather modeling. Grid computing is a critical shift in thinking about how to maximize the value of computing resources. Advantages of grid computing ieee computer society. Failover to another node within the grid eliminates the need for a hot standby.
Please see our welcome document for more information. Grid computing could be defined as any of a variety of levels of virtualization along a continuum. Additionally, the term grid implies both ubiquity and predictability, with grids being viewed as very much analogous to electrical or power grids,1 which are accessible everywhere and. Typically, a grid works on various tasks within a network, but it is also capable of working on specialized. As described earlier, initially, the focused grid computing activities were in the areas of computing power, data access, and storage resources. Computational grid is a collection of distributed, possibly heterogeneous resources which can be used as an ensemble to execute largescale applications. Grid computing requires the use of software that can divide and farm out pieces of a program to as many as several thousand computers. Introduction to sas grid computing sas grid manager provides a shared, centrally managed analytic computing environment that provides high availability and accelerates processing. Grid computing will provide a richer means for collaboration on a scale that surpasses those currently available with distributed computing. This book explores processes and techniques needed to create a successful grid infrastructure. Grid computing is distinguished from the cluster computing, because in. December 4, 2002 introduction to grid computing 10 broader context zgrid computing has much in common with major industrial thrusts businesstobusiness, peertopeer, application service providers, storage service providers, distributed computing, internet computing zsharing issues not adequately addressed by existing technologies. Grid computing combines computers from multiple administrative domains to reach a common goal, to solve a single task, and may then disappear just as quickly. In addition, the article also tries to bring into focus the relationship grid computing has to electronic health records ehr systems.
Grid computing is basically taking a number of inexpensive personal computers. The main point of grid software ive used has been to balance the needs of multiple users, and ensure the right environment is set up on the target node. Grid computing is the use of widely distributed computer resources to reach a common goal. The grid can be thought as a distributed system with noninteractive workloads that involve a large no. During the 1980s and 1990s, software for parallel computers focused on. Their incredibuildxge xoreax grid engine software uses a unique technology called process level virtualization to create a virtual hpc machine. There are obvious benefits in having a shared, heterogeneous grid, so there is a broader context in which all distributed computing happens, and that is the notion that the very network or fabric. We are pleased to announce the opening of compute grid 2.
Grid computing and all its benefits are not a new concept to it professionals. This page is your guide to start learning about the exciting benefits that grid computing can offer. Our electric grid once gave us a competitive advantage, but now its causing us to fall behind. Grid computing can be defined in many ways but for these discussions lets simply call it a way to execute compute jobs e. Grid computing is a processor architecture that combines computer resources from various domains to reach a main objective. How grid computing may improve systems performance fincad. It provides workload management to optimally process multiple applications and workloads to maximize overall throughput.
Flexible gridcomputing capabilities allow portfolio managers to conduct simulations that. The popularity of this data storage technology has led to a number of vendor. There is no technology called grid computing, there are no products that implement grid computing. Through the cloud, you can assemble and use vast computer grids for specific time periods and purposes, paying, if necessary, only for what you use to save both the time. Grid computing is a technique in which the idle systems in the network and their.
87 233 970 1494 594 1582 959 657 1200 309 785 958 622 441 127 422 1558 245 1274 706 498 1039 700 1327 853 124 1381 1388 647 654 595 1085 562 787 793 122 960 565 881 1432 271 1481 847 174